Understanding the Foundations: Nutrition & Metabolism Essentials
To truly grasp how fat loss occurs, we must first understand the bedrock principles of nutrition and metabolism. These two forces work in tandem, dictating how your body acquires, uses, and stores energy.
What is Nutrition? Fueling Your Body
Nutrition is simply the process of providing or obtaining the food necessary for health and growth. Our bodies require a diverse array of nutrients, categorized into two main groups:
- Macronutrients: These are the nutrients our bodies need in large amounts to provide energy. They include carbohydrates, proteins, and fats.
- Micronutrients: These are vitamins and minerals, required in smaller quantities but vital for countless bodily functions, from immune support to energy production.
Each macronutrient plays a unique role, contributing to your overall energy intake and impact on body composition.
Metabolism: Your Body’s Energy Engine
Metabolism refers to all the chemical processes that occur within your body to maintain life. It’s how your body converts food and drinks into energy. This complex process is constantly at work, even when you’re resting or sleeping.
Key components of your metabolism include:
- Basal Metabolic Rate (BMR): The number of calories your body burns at rest to perform basic life-sustaining functions like breathing, circulation, and cell production.
- Thermic Effect of Food (TEF): The energy expended to digest, absorb, and metabolize the food you eat. Protein has the highest TEF.
- Activity Energy Expenditure (AEE): Calories burned during physical activity, including structured exercise and non-exercise activity thermogenesis (NEAT).
The sum of these components makes up your Total Daily Energy Expenditure (TDEE), representing the total calories your body burns in a day.
The Scientific Mechanism of Fat Loss
At its core, fat loss is a matter of energy balance. This isn’t a fad; it’s a fundamental law of thermodynamics applied to the human body. Understanding this concept is pivotal for anyone serious about sustainable fat reduction.
The Calorie Deficit Principle
Your body stores excess energy as fat. Therefore, to lose fat, you must consistently consume fewer calories than your body expends. This state is known as a calorie deficit.
- Energy In: Calories consumed from food and drink.
- Energy Out: Calories burned through BMR, TEF, and AEE.
When ‘Energy In’ is less than ‘Energy Out,’ your body taps into its stored fat reserves for energy, leading to fat loss. It sounds simple, but consistency and accuracy are key.
Hormonal Influences on Fat Metabolism
While a calorie deficit is paramount, hormones play a significant role in regulating hunger, satiety, and how your body prioritizes fuel sources. Hormones like insulin, leptin, and ghrelin influence your appetite and metabolic rate, making the process feel more challenging at times.
For instance, insulin helps transport glucose into cells for energy or storage. Consistently high insulin levels, often triggered by refined carbohydrates, can promote fat storage and hinder fat mobilization. Understanding these interactions helps in making smarter food choices.
The Pivotal Role of Macronutrients & Calories in Fat Loss
Every calorie you consume comes from one of the three macronutrients. The balance of these macros profoundly impacts your satiety, energy levels, and body composition during a fat loss phase.
Calories: The Universal Energy Currency
A calorie is simply a unit of energy. Whether it comes from protein, carbs, or fat, a calorie is a calorie in terms of its energy value. However, the source of those calories profoundly affects how your body processes them and how satisfied you feel.
Protein: Your Ally for Satiety and Muscle Preservation
Protein is arguably the most crucial macronutrient for fat loss. It provides:
- High Satiety: Protein keeps you feeling full for longer, reducing overall calorie intake.
- Muscle Preservation: During a calorie deficit, adequate protein intake helps preserve lean muscle mass, which is metabolically active.
- High Thermic Effect: Your body burns more calories digesting protein compared to fats or carbohydrates.
Aim for lean protein sources like chicken breast, fish, eggs, legumes, and Greek yogurt.
Carbohydrates: Energy and Performance
Often demonized, carbohydrates are your body’s primary and preferred energy source. They fuel your brain and muscles, particularly during exercise.
- Complex Carbs: Found in whole grains, fruits, and vegetables, these provide sustained energy and fiber.
- Simple Carbs: Found in sugars and refined grains, these offer quick energy but can lead to blood sugar spikes and crashes.
Focus on nutrient-dense, fiber-rich carbohydrates to manage blood sugar and enhance satiety.
Fats: Essential for Health and Hormone Function
Dietary fats are vital for hormone production, nutrient absorption, and overall cellular function. While calorie-dense, healthy fats are crucial for health.
- Unsaturated Fats: Found in avocados, nuts, seeds, and olive oil, these are beneficial for heart health.
- Saturated Fats: Found in animal products, consume in moderation.
Include healthy fat sources in your diet, being mindful of portion sizes due to their high caloric density.
Debunking Common Nutrition & Fat Loss Myths
The world of health and fitness is rife with misinformation. Let’s separate fact from fiction with a scientific lens, focusing on Nutrition & Fat Loss Science.
Myth 1: Carbs Make You Fat
Science Says: No single macronutrient causes fat gain. Excess calories, regardless of their source, lead to fat storage. Complex carbohydrates, rich in fiber, are beneficial for satiety and gut health.
Myth 2: You Must Starve Yourself to Lose Weight
Science Says: Extreme calorie restriction is unsustainable and counterproductive. It can lead to nutrient deficiencies, muscle loss, and a slower metabolism. A moderate, consistent calorie deficit is far more effective.
Myth 3: Spot Reduction is Possible
Science Says: You cannot target fat loss from specific body parts. When you lose fat, it comes off proportionally from all over your body. Targeted exercises build muscle, but don’t selectively burn fat.
Myth 4: Detox Diets Cleanse Your System
Science Says: Your liver and kidneys are incredibly efficient at detoxifying your body naturally. Most ‘detox’ products are ineffective and can even be harmful, often leading to temporary water weight loss rather than true fat reduction.
Practical Fat Loss Strategies Backed by Nutrition Science
Armed with a solid understanding of Nutrition & Fat Loss Science, it’s time to translate that knowledge into actionable steps. These strategies are proven to support sustainable fat loss.
Prioritize Protein Intake
As discussed, protein is your best friend. Aim for 0.7-1 gram of protein per pound of body weight (or 1.6-2.2 grams per kg) daily, distributing it evenly across your meals. This maximizes satiety and helps preserve muscle mass.
Embrace Fiber-Rich Foods
Fiber, found in fruits, vegetables, whole grains, and legumes, promotes fullness, aids digestion, and can help regulate blood sugar levels. Incorporating plenty of fiber into your diet is a simple yet powerful strategy.
Stay Hydrated
Water is essential for nearly every bodily function, including metabolism. Drinking enough water can also help you feel fuller and reduce the likelihood of mistaking thirst for hunger.
Practice Mindful Eating
Pay attention to your hunger and satiety cues. Eat slowly, savor your food, and avoid distractions. This helps you recognize when you’re truly full, preventing overeating.
Incorporate Strength Training
While often associated with muscle building, resistance training is crucial for fat loss. It helps preserve and build lean muscle mass, which boosts your metabolic rate, making your body a more efficient fat-burning machine.
Optimize Sleep Quality
Poor sleep can disrupt hormones that regulate appetite (ghrelin and leptin), leading to increased hunger and cravings. Aim for 7-9 hours of quality sleep per night to support your fat loss efforts.
Common Mistakes & Misconceptions on Your Journey
Even with the best intentions, pitfalls can derail your progress. Recognizing these common mistakes can help you navigate your journey more effectively.
Over-Restricting and Crash Dieting
While a calorie deficit is necessary, an overly aggressive one can lead to extreme hunger, nutrient deficiencies, and metabolic adaptation that makes future fat loss harder. Moderation and sustainability are key.
Ignoring Hunger and Satiety Cues
Constantly fighting your body’s natural signals can lead to rebound eating. Learn to differentiate between physical hunger and emotional cravings, and respect your body’s signals when possible.
Underestimating Calorie Intake
Many people unknowingly consume more calories than they think, especially from sauces, dressings, and snacks. Briefly tracking your intake can provide valuable awareness without becoming an obsession.
Focusing Solely on the Scale
The scale can be a useful tool, but it doesn’t tell the whole story. Fluctuations in water weight, muscle gain, and digestive contents can obscure true fat loss. Consider other metrics like body measurements, how clothes fit, and progress photos.
Lack of Consistency
Fat loss is a marathon, not a sprint. Occasional slip-ups are normal, but consistent adherence to your strategies over time is what yields lasting results. Patience and persistence are vital.
Frequently Asked Questions About Nutrition & Fat Loss Science
Q1: How quickly can I expect to lose fat safely?
A safe and sustainable rate of fat loss is typically 1-2 pounds (0.5-1 kg) per week. Faster rates are often unsustainable and can lead to muscle loss and nutrient deficiencies.
Q2: Do I need to cut out carbs completely to lose fat?
No, completely cutting out carbs is not necessary for fat loss and can be detrimental to energy levels and overall health. Focusing on complex, fiber-rich carbohydrates in appropriate portions is a more sustainable approach.
Q3: Is intermittent fasting effective for fat loss?
Intermittent fasting (IF) can be an effective tool for some people, primarily by helping to create a calorie deficit. It’s a method of eating, not a magic bullet, and its effectiveness depends on overall calorie intake and adherence.
Q4: What role does exercise play in fat loss?
Exercise, particularly a combination of strength training and cardiovascular activity, is incredibly important. It burns calories, builds muscle (boosting metabolism), improves body composition, and enhances overall health and well-being. It complements, but does not replace, a proper nutritional approach.
Q5: How important is sleep for fat loss?
Sleep is critically important. Insufficient sleep can negatively impact hormones that regulate hunger and satiety (ghrelin and leptin), increase cortisol (a stress hormone linked to fat storage), and reduce energy for exercise, making fat loss significantly harder.
Q6: Can supplements help with fat loss?
Most fat loss supplements have limited scientific backing and are often ineffective. Focus on a balanced diet, consistent exercise, and adequate sleep first. If considering supplements, consult a healthcare professional.
Q7: How do I maintain fat loss long-term?
Long-term maintenance involves adopting sustainable lifestyle habits rather than temporary diets. This includes consistent healthy eating, regular physical activity, stress management, and adequate sleep. It’s about building a lifestyle, not just reaching a destination.
